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2123811 29 791031778 64485142
43 28261 5765858359
43 28261 5765858359
20 274 50
All about undefined
Interested in learning more?
43 28261 5765858359
20 274 50
See more
38931 79 968633680
82525393 63164732 1954 90396 5118709
See more
1840 6711195445 754
65038 192592125 158677177 10396
See more